Summary

Green Expert Technology Inc. (GreenXT) is seeking a System Administrator to support the Naval Logistics Technical Data (NAVLOGTD) program.

This position is expected to be three days in office, two days telework.

Responsibilities:
  • Provide troubleshooting, support, maintenance, and enhancement for the NAVLOGTD data repository.
  • Provide support for system upgrades/design for the next generation of NAVLOGTD system to meet goal of reducing the overall number of servers and supporting equipment.
  • Maintain and support program management for Specifications and Standards, including the equipment Commonality program.
  • Provide help desk and support for the NSWCPD Remedy system.
  • Perform server maintenance
  • Perform backups to manage and maintain the server load

Requirements:
  • U.S. Citizen with an active Secret clearance
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ering or Computer Science from an accredited college or university.
  • Three (3) years of experience in one of the following two areas: 1) System administration, management, or design of IT server resources in support of computer networks OR 2) Three (3) years of professional experience in software development.
  • IAT-I or IAT-II certification
